The water tiles show great promise albeit they need a cosmetic going over still.

My question is: How will water affect unit movement?

- Will it prevent passage or slow the units down as they cross the water?
- If so will this apply for all units or are there exeptions to this rule?
- Will ships/boats be implemented at some point to further trade - specifically quantity?
- Will cities lying adjacent to water be more vulnerable to attack?
- Will fishing be implemented in soveregnty as a means to enhance food production in a city?
- Lastly - Will there be monsters below?

Only answering the ones I know.


- Will it prevent passage or slow the units down as they cross the water?
Yes.  You will eventually have to go around water, or over it (bridges), not sure what else.  Also, naval things are planned.  I'm ONABOAT!

- If so will this apply for all units or are there exeptions to this rule?
Pretty sure it will impact all units. 


- Will ships/boats be implemented at some point to further trade - specifically quantity?
Yeah, they said navy stuff and boats, docks, new buildings related to waterways, etc will be added.  They have lots on the drawing board and are still organizing what to add (I think).

- Will cities lying adjacent to water be more vulnerable to attack?
That depends.  Enemies will have to cross the water to attack you from the side with water.  Otherwise their attacks will have to come around the water.




- Lastly - Will there be monsters below?
Sea monsters?  possible.  Heard it discussed but I'm no authority on the subject.  I think the staff themselves are kicking a lot of ideas around to make it as cool as possible when they eventually code it all Approve
